在实际应用中,三者的区别是明确的。
当你不再需要该表时, 用 drop;
当你仍要保留该表,但要删除所有记录时, 用 truncate;
当你要删除部分记录时(always with a WHERE clause), 用 delete.
drop truncate delete区别
最新推荐文章于 2024-07-21 20:20:18 发布
本文详细解释了在SQL中使用drop、truncate和delete的区别。drop用于完全删除表,truncate用于清空表数据但保留表结构,而delete则用于有条件地删除表中的部分记录。
4692

被折叠的 条评论
为什么被折叠?



